What Is the Cost of Living Near Decatur?

Understanding the cost of living near Decatur is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Carnegie Visual Arts Center.
Decatur's Cost of Living Index is approximately 78.1 (21.9% less expensive than US average; 5.1% less than AL average). Primary drivers for affordability are significantly lower housing costs.
